计算机技术与软件专业技术资格(水平)考试,简称“软考”,是中国计算机专业技术领域内一项重要的职业资格认证。软考内容广泛,覆盖了计算机技术的多个领域,旨在评估和认证专业技术人员的技术水平与能力。本文将重点介绍软考的整体考试内容,并深入解析其中与“计算机系统服务”相关的核心模块。
一、软考总体考试内容概览
软考分为初级、中级和高级三个级别,每个级别下设多个专业方向,如软件设计师、网络工程师、系统架构设计师等。但无论哪个级别或方向,考试内容通常涵盖以下几个核心知识领域:
- 计算机基础与体系结构:包括计算机组成原理、操作系统、数据通信与网络基础等。
- 软件工程与开发技术:涉及软件开发过程、需求分析、设计模式、编程语言、测试与维护等。
- 项目管理与法律法规:包括项目计划、成本控制、风险管理,以及知识产权、标准化、相关法律法规等。
- 特定专业技术领域:根据报考方向的不同,深入考查如网络技术、数据库、信息安全、嵌入式系统等专业知识。
考试形式通常包括上午的综合知识选择题和下午的案例分析、论文或设计题。
二、核心聚焦:计算机系统服务模块
“计算机系统服务”是软考多个专业方向(尤其是系统架构、系统集成、信息系统管理等相关方向)中一个至关重要的知识模块。它并不仅指狭义上的“服务”概念,而是涵盖了支撑计算机系统稳定、高效、安全运行的一系列关键技术与活动。其主要内容包括:
- 操作系统服务与管理:
- 进程与线程管理:进程调度、同步与通信、死锁处理。
- 存储管理:内存分配、虚拟内存、文件系统管理。
- 设备管理:I/O控制、驱动程序、即插即用服务。
- 系统安全与访问控制:用户认证、权限管理、安全审计。
- 网络系统服务:
- 基础网络服务:DNS(域名解析)、DHCP(动态主机配置)、网络路由与交换。
- 应用层服务:Web服务(HTTP/HTTPS)、文件传输(FTP)、电子邮件服务。
- 目录服务:如LDAP,用于集中管理和认证网络资源。
- 系统集成与运维服务:
- 系统配置与管理:服务器部署、资源监控(CPU、内存、磁盘、网络)、性能调优。
- 高可用性与容灾:集群技术、负载均衡、备份与恢复策略。
- 虚拟化与云计算服务:虚拟机管理、容器技术、云服务模型(IaaS, PaaS, SaaS)及其管理。
- 中间件与支撑服务:
- 数据库服务:数据库管理系统的安装、配置、优化与备份。
- 消息队列与事务处理:保证分布式系统间可靠通信与数据一致性。
- Web服务器与应用服务器:如Apache, Nginx, Tomcat等的配置与管理。
- 安全服务:
- 基础安全服务:防火墙、入侵检测/防御系统(IDS/IPS)、VPN。
- 高级安全服务:漏洞扫描、安全事件管理(SIEM)、身份管理与访问控制(IAM)。
三、在软考中的考查形式与备考建议
在软考中,“计算机系统服务”相关知识通常会融入各个科目的考题中。例如:
- 选择题:考查基础概念、原理和常见服务的功能特点。
- 案例分析题:提供一个实际的系统运维、故障排查或架构设计场景,要求考生分析问题并提出基于系统服务管理的解决方案。
- 论文(高级):可能要求就系统服务的某个发展趋势(如云原生服务、智能化运维)进行论述。
备考建议:
1. 夯实基础:深入理解操作系统、计算机网络等核心课程的理论知识。
2. 实践结合:尽可能在实际环境或实验平台中操作和配置常见的系统服务,加深理解。
3. 关注趋势:了解云计算、DevOps、微服务等新技术对传统系统服务模式带来的变革。
4. 研读考纲与真题:明确当年具体报考方向的考试大纲,并通过历年真题把握出题重点和风格。
计算机软考的“计算机系统服务”模块是连接硬件、软件与业务应用的桥梁,是构建和维护可靠IT基础设施的核心能力。考生需从理论到实践全面掌握,方能在考试与实际工作中游刃有余。